Quarterly Planning Note — Divestiture of the Coastal Tooling Unit

For the finance team: the sale of the Coastal Tooling unit to Pellmark Industries remains on track for close in Q3. Please finalize the carve-out balance sheet, reconcile intercompany positions, and prepare the working-capital adjustment schedule by month-end. Audit support requests should be prioritized. For planning purposes, note the following sensitive item:

internal memo for hawef-kahif: The finance team signed off on a budget of $25.9 million for Project Sorox. The renewal with Pelokek Logistics closes at $51.7 million a year, 52 percent below the last contract.

Subject: EXIF scrubbing ownership change

Team, quick note ahead of the weekly sync. The image EXIF scrubbing pipeline in Pixelvane is moving out of the Uploads squad. This covers the strip-on-ingest job, the backfill script for legacy assets, and the quarterly verification sweep. Open tickets will be retagged by Friday; no behavior changes are planned this quarter. Going forward, all questions, escalations, and review requests for EXIF scrubbing should be directed to the new owner named below.

account owner for bawip-tahag: Raleth Quenok

To the dispatch desk: the stamped blueprints for the Larchfield Annex building permit are ready for collection from the Orvane Planning Bureau. Receiving site is the site office at Larchfield, attention of the permits clerk. The tube must stay sealed in transit. On arrival, the courier should observe this instruction:

dispatch memo: the lamwyn fenwyn courier leaves the wenir ledger at gate 7175 under passcode 822969

Hi Merel, quick handover before I'm off tomorrow. The signed Vastelaan contracts are boxed and sealed in the records cupboard at the Noordkade office — three folders, all countersigned by the Brenneke side. They need to go to our Zuidplein branch before Thursday so legal can file them. Please line up whichever driver is free; the box is light but the contents are originals, so no detours. Pass the following instruction to the driver verbatim:

dispatch memo: the eliok quenok courier leaves the sorael aldath belion tammir casix gileth queniel jorath ledger at gate 9299 under passcode 897989